Cuba's 1980s wildlife conservation series was produced largely for the international collector market rather than domestic circulation, a common revenue strategy among Caribbean states during the dollar-scarce years of Cold War socialism. The iguana issues in particular were targeted at European numismatic distributors, with the Cuban state mint working through intermediaries to convert hard currency.
The Cuban rock iguana, Cyclura nubila, was listed under CITES Appendix II by the time this coin appeared.
